Windows 8 not aimed at the Tech Crowd
With all due respect to the TechRepublic crowd, Windows 8 is just not aimed at us. It seems to me that Microsoft built Windows 8 for the home/personal computing and BYOD marketplaces. It won't play well in a business environment because 99% of business apps and web sites currently are not touch enabled. Microsoft wants Windows 8 users to download new touch enabled apps, not to keep using old stuff.
Look, if MS sells Windows and Office to a business desktop user, they have no reason to ever go back to MS again to buy anything. I can tell you MS wants to sell apps from their app store more than anything.
